Released in 2001, Beth is a drama film directed by Aria Kusumadewa, running about 80 minutes.

What it’s about. The story takes place in a mental hospital. Many things are going on. There is Pesta (Bucek Depp), a junky who was moved from a prison to the hospital. He meets Beth (Ine Febriyanti), the daughter of a high-ranking government official, who asked that her daughter gets a special treatment, but this must remain a secret. There are a poet, a politician and a nurse who was an ex-patient, and Beth’s helper, also Rehan (Nurul Arifin) who has her own set of problems. The doctors at the hospital seem no different from the patients. There is also an artist who makes installation art works. His artistic doctrin is: the more complicated it is for a work of art to be understood, the better. It is unclear if the artist is the hospital 's patient, because he is never inside of the hospital but is always in the courtyard.

Who’s in it. Beth stars Sha Ine Febriyanti as Beth, Bucek Depp as Pesta, Nurul Arifin as Suster Rehan and Lola Amaria as Suster Zaenab.
